Stock Market Today, June 1: Stock Market Today, June 1: UiPath Rises After Strong Q1 Results and Raised Outlook

UiPath surged 11.9% after reporting fiscal Q1 2027 results with 17% revenue growth, positive GAAP operating income of $28 million, and raised guidance. The company's annual recurring revenue reached $1.901 billion, up 12%. However, Bank of America maintained an Underperform rating despite raising its price target, noting investors must monitor continued ARR growth and agentic automation adoption. The broader market saw S&P 500 gain 0.27% and Nasdaq climb 0.42%, with strong performance from AI and cloud infrastructure stocks.

UiPath Reports Mixed Q1: Earnings Miss, Revenue Beats

UiPath reported mixed Q1 results with earnings per share of 15 cents missing the Street estimate of 16 cents, but quarterly revenue of $418.38 million beat consensus estimates of $397.81 million by 5.17%. The company's Annual Recurring Revenue (ARR) grew 12% year-over-year to $1.901 billion, with CEO Daniel Dines highlighting progress in agentic products moving from pilot to production. UiPath stock rose 1.04% to $11.70 in extended trading, though 36.28% of shares were sold short heading into the earnings release.

Why UiPath Stock Is Surging On Tuesday?

UiPath stock rose 0.38% on Tuesday following the company's announcement of launching its Automation Cloud on Microsoft Azure in South Korea. The expansion provides local data residency and enterprise-grade agentic automation capabilities, addressing strict data sovereignty requirements. The partnership targets regulated industries like banking and the public sector, with IDC data showing 24% of South Korean organizations have already implemented agentic AI and 67% plan to within 12 months.

UiPath, Inc. provides an automation platform that offers a range of robotic process automation (RPA) solutions primarily in the United States, Romania, the United Kingdom, the Netherlands, and internationally. It offers the UiPath platform, an integrated enterprise software platform that enables AI agents, robots, people, and models to work together in coordinated workflows. The company's UiPath platform includes the UiPath Maestro process orchestration and process intelligence; UiPath agent builder; RPA and API automation; UiPath intelligent xtraction and processing; UiPath test cloud for testing and quality assurance; UiPath packaged and prebuilt agentic solutions; and centralized governance capabilities that apply across automations, AI agents, and manual tasks. It serves the financial services, healthcare, manufacturing, retail, and public sectors. The company was founded in 2005 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
